4. Benefit Benetint:
This combined with my favorite mascara will bring you from day time to night time in a few swipes. It's a lip and cheek stain, which I think is a brilliant idea since your natural lip and cheek color should be somewhat uniform. I find its best to layer it on, and although the directions tell you to apply it in dots and then blend I usually like to just swipe it wherever I want it and then blend with a brush. Did I mention it smells AMAZING?
